The use of the Germany ticket is very popular among travelers, since it not only enables the exploration of German cities, but also makes the journey to neighboring countries attractive. Subscribers can use local transport all over Germany for only 49 euros per month, and there are some connections that lead beyond the borders. These options are particularly tempting on long weekends or for spontaneous excursions.

The 49-euro ticket is a real bargain for everyone who likes to travel by train. This allows not only German cities, but also goals in Austria, Switzerland, France, Luxembourg and even Poland. While the ticket applies across Germany, it is important to note that there is also no validity abroad on all routes. It is therefore recommended to find out about the specific connections and transport associations before the trip. Changes are possible here at any time.

popular travel destinations with the Germany ticket

One of the most exciting goals is Salzburg. The trip from Munich to Salzburg in the Regional Express RE5 takes less than two hours. HIT is often mentioned as the birthplace of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art as well as the impressive Salzburg festival and the beautiful old town, which is UNESCO World Heritage Site. Visitors have the opportunity to visit Hellbrunn Castle, known for its impressive architecture and the famous water features.

Another popular goal is Switzerland, especially Basel. Travelers can drive across the border with the regional train RB27 or RE7 and enjoy a breathtaking view from the terrace on Basler Münster, one of the most striking landmarks in the city. The old town of Basel inspires with its colorful brick roofs and a variety of art exhibitions in the Kunstmuseum Basel, which houses masterpieces of artists such as Vincent van Gogh and Claude Monet.

from North Rhine-Westphalia can travelers get to Venlo in the Netherlands in just an hour and a half. Venlo is known for his lively art scene and the impressive museum van Bommel van Dam. Nature lovers can visit the botanical garden that offers a fair selection of exotic and historical plants. The Toverland amusement park is the right choice for adventure - with many attractions for the whole family.

For a relaxing journey into nature, a visit to the Müllerthals in Luxembourg is ideal. The region is famous for its impressive rock formations and beautiful landscapes, ideal for hikers and nature lovers. The wide range of museums and the picturesque old town of Luxembourg, which has been a UNESCO World Heritage Site since 1994, make the city an attractive destination.

The Alsace is another attractive goal that can be achieved with the Germany ticket. Travelers get from Karlsruhe to Wissembourg, where the charming old town with its historic half -timbered houses invites you to a stroll through the city. The surroundings are perfect for hikes through the picturesque vineyards, and the Nordvosesen nature park attracts with its untouched nature.

For beach lovers, the trip to the Baltic Sea in Poland is a good option. Via the Usedom Bäderbahn, travelers reach the city of Swinoujście with the Germany ticket. Here breathtaking beaches and the impressive lighthouse, which is one of the highest on the Baltic Sea, are waiting for you. The view of the 67.7 meters high is simply spectacular and in good weather, visitors can look up to the German coast.
